Owasso Band Students Spending Spring Break In Ireland To March In Parade
Cal Day
More than 200 Owasso band students will spend their spring break in Ireland to march in Dublin’s Saint Patrick’s Day Parade. They will also get to tour the Cliffs of Moher, the Titanic history museum and even a sheep farm.

Pride Of Owasso Band Takes Home Top Honors
Matt Rahn
When you walk into the Owasso High School band building at any given time, you’re bound to hear something good. It's that kind of hard work that led to the program bringing home perfect scores from the State Concert Contest.

Green Country High School Band Called On To Be Pep Band For TU Rival
News On 6
In 2010, UTEP hired Owasso's band as its pep band when the team played in Tulsa. UTEP made a run at the championship that season, and called the band back for an encore performance.
